Q: Is 1,353,250 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 1,353,250 is a composite number.

Why is 1,353,250 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 1,353,250 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 25 50 125 250 5,413 10,826 27,065 54,130 135,325 270,650 676,625 and 1,353,250, with no remainder.

Since 1,353,250 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,353,250, it is a composite number.
